Jeff Bezos’ net worth
After starting Amazon as an online bookstore in 1994, Jeff Bezos quickly became a billionaire. He was worth $1.6 billion in 1998.
According to Forbes, his net worth reached $11 billion in 2010, and since then it has skyrocketed to over £26 billion. After starting Amazon as an online bookstore in 1994, Bezos became the world’s richest person 23 years later, in 2017.
His fortune soared to an unprecedented $160 billion in 2018, then dropped to $114 billion in 2019. Until now, Bezos had the most wealth of any individual on the planet.
Two years later, however, SpaceX founder Elon Musk overtook him.
He lost the lead this week to Gautam Adani and Bernard Arnault, two new billionaires.
Don’t feel too bad about Bezos, though. As of this writing, Forbes estimates his wealth to be $148.1 billion.
His dethroning from the top spot is more attributable to others’ economic success than to his own financial mismanagement.
His personal fortune is heavily dependent on the performance of Amazon’s stock, which has been declining as people spend less time at home due to fewer precautions against pandemics and more time engaging in outside activities.
With a current market cap of $1.27 trillion, the company is still an e-commerce behemoth.
